On Sunday 23 December 2007 18:33:02 Clifford Wolf wrote: > Hi, > > On Sun, Dec 23, 2007 at 10:50:16AM +0100, Clifford Wolf wrote: > > but there is one massive problem: I can't save my current project. If I > > try it, everything looks fine in the GUI but no project file is created. > > The following line in kdenlive/projectformatmanager.cpp always sets filter > to NULL which causes the SaveAs slot of the application to do nothing: > > SaveProjectFilter *filter = findSaveFormat(format->name()); > > it would help me a bit with debugging this problem if someone on this list > could write a short explanation on what should happen here. In my case > format and url evaluate to: > > format->name() is 'application/octet-stream' > url.url() is 'file:///root/demo.kdenlive' > > Afaics format->name() should better be something like > 'application/vnd.kde.kdenlive'. Do I need to add some kde settings to make > this work? How? Where? (I'm not really a C++ or Qt/KDE guy, more the > C/operating systems/digital electronics person who wants to use kdenlive > for creating a podcast with low-level electronic courses. ;-)
Hi. Thanks for looking at this issue. Where did you install kdenlive ? The problem seems to be that the file: vnd.kde.kdenlive.desktop was not installed in a correct place. This file goes in $PREFIX/share/mimelnk/application Please, try copying it to $HOME/.kde/share/mimelnk/application and restart kdenlive to see if it fixes the issue. > In any case I urgly recommend that ProjectFormatManager::saveDocument() > at least displays an error dialog in this situation instead of failing > silently..
